Subject: [PATCH 3/8] media: hantro: hevc: Allow 10-bits encoded streams
Date: Fri, 4 Jun 2021 15:06:14 +0200 [thread overview]
Message-ID: <20210604130619.491200-4-benjamin.gaignard@collabora.com> (raw)
In-Reply-To: <20210604130619.491200-1-benjamin.gaignard@collabora.com>
Allow to use 10-bits encoded streams but force the output
to remain in 8-bits.
Add a function to get chroma offset for the output since
it may now not match with internal reference buffers chroma
offset.
Signed-off-by: Benjamin Gaignard <benjamin.gaignard@collabora.com>
---
drivers/staging/media/hantro/hantro_drv.c | 5 ++--
.../staging/media/hantro/hantro_g2_hevc_dec.c | 29 +++++++++++++++----
drivers/staging/media/hantro/hantro_g2_regs.h | 1 +
drivers/staging/media/hantro/hantro_hevc.c | 5 ++--
4 files changed, 31 insertions(+), 9 deletions(-)
diff --git a/drivers/staging/media/hantro/hantro_drv.c b/drivers/staging/media/hantro/hantro_drv.c
index 6053c86b1c3f..43feb14bbbba 100644
--- a/drivers/staging/media/hantro/hantro_drv.c
+++ b/drivers/staging/media/hantro/hantro_drv.c
@@ -263,8 +263,9 @@ static int hantro_try_ctrl(struct v4l2_ctrl *ctrl)
if (sps->bit_depth_luma_minus8 != sps->bit_depth_chroma_minus8)
/* Luma and chroma bit depth mismatch */
return -EINVAL;
- if (sps->bit_depth_luma_minus8 != 0)
- /* Only 8-bit is supported */
+ if (sps->bit_depth_luma_minus8 != 0 &&
+ sps->bit_depth_luma_minus8 != 2)
+ /* Only 8-bit or 10-bit is supported */
return -EINVAL;
if (sps->flags & V4L2_HEVC_SPS_FLAG_SCALING_LIST_ENABLED)
/* No scaling support */
diff --git a/drivers/staging/media/hantro/hantro_g2_hevc_dec.c b/drivers/staging/media/hantro/hantro_g2_hevc_dec.c
index 9a715e803037..df147b69a31f 100644
--- a/drivers/staging/media/hantro/hantro_g2_hevc_dec.c
+++ b/drivers/staging/media/hantro/hantro_g2_hevc_dec.c
@@ -133,6 +133,16 @@ static void prepare_tile_info_buffer(struct hantro_ctx *ctx)
vpu_debug(1, "%s: no chroma!\n", __func__);
}
+static bool is_8bit_dst_format(struct hantro_ctx *ctx)
+{
+ switch (ctx->vpu_dst_fmt->fourcc) {
+ case V4L2_PIX_FMT_NV12:
+ return true;
+ default:
+ return false;
+ }
+}
+
static void set_params(struct hantro_ctx *ctx)
{
const struct hantro_hevc_dec_ctrls *ctrls = &ctx->hevc_dec.ctrls;
@@ -148,7 +158,8 @@ static void set_params(struct hantro_ctx *ctx)
hantro_reg_write(vpu, &g2_bit_depth_y_minus8, sps->bit_depth_luma_minus8);
hantro_reg_write(vpu, &g2_bit_depth_c_minus8, sps->bit_depth_chroma_minus8);
- hantro_reg_write(vpu, &g2_output_8_bits, 0);
+ hantro_reg_write(vpu, &g2_output_8_bits, 1);
+ hantro_reg_write(vpu, &g2_output_format, 0);
hantro_reg_write(vpu, &g2_hdr_skip_length, ctrls->hevc_hdr_skip_length);
@@ -511,13 +522,21 @@ static int set_ref(struct hantro_ctx *ctx)
return 0;
}
+static size_t hantro_hevc_output_chroma_offset(struct hantro_ctx *ctx)
+{
+ const struct hantro_hevc_dec_ctrls *ctrls = &ctx->hevc_dec.ctrls;
+ const struct v4l2_ctrl_hevc_sps *sps = ctrls->sps;
+ int bytes_per_pixel = is_8bit_dst_format(ctx) ? 1 : 2;
+
+ return sps->pic_width_in_luma_samples *
+ sps->pic_height_in_luma_samples * bytes_per_pixel;
+}
+
static void set_buffers(struct hantro_ctx *ctx)
{
struct vb2_v4l2_buffer *src_buf, *dst_buf;
struct hantro_dev *vpu = ctx->dev;
- const struct hantro_hevc_dec_ctrls *ctrls = &ctx->hevc_dec.ctrls;
- const struct v4l2_ctrl_hevc_sps *sps = ctrls->sps;
- size_t cr_offset = hantro_hevc_chroma_offset(sps);
+ size_t output_cr_offset = hantro_hevc_output_chroma_offset(ctx);
dma_addr_t src_dma, dst_dma;
u32 src_len, src_buf_len;
@@ -539,7 +558,7 @@ static void set_buffers(struct hantro_ctx *ctx)
dst_dma = hantro_get_dec_buf_addr(ctx, &dst_buf->vb2_buf);
hantro_write_addr(vpu, G2_RASTER_SCAN, dst_dma);
- hantro_write_addr(vpu, G2_RASTER_SCAN_CHR, dst_dma + cr_offset);
+ hantro_write_addr(vpu, G2_RASTER_SCAN_CHR, dst_dma + output_cr_offset);
hantro_write_addr(vpu, G2_ADDR_TILE_SIZE, ctx->hevc_dec.tile_sizes.dma);
hantro_write_addr(vpu, G2_TILE_FILTER, ctx->hevc_dec.tile_filter.dma);
hantro_write_addr(vpu, G2_TILE_SAO, ctx->hevc_dec.tile_sao.dma);
diff --git a/drivers/staging/media/hantro/hantro_g2_regs.h b/drivers/staging/media/hantro/hantro_g2_regs.h
index 0414d92e3860..941e5482d27b 100644
--- a/drivers/staging/media/hantro/hantro_g2_regs.h
+++ b/drivers/staging/media/hantro/hantro_g2_regs.h
@@ -77,6 +77,7 @@
#define g2_bit_depth_y_minus8 G2_DEC_REG(8, 6, 0x3)
#define g2_bit_depth_c_minus8 G2_DEC_REG(8, 4, 0x3)
#define g2_output_8_bits G2_DEC_REG(8, 3, 0x1)
+#define g2_output_format G2_DEC_REG(8, 0, 0x7)
#define g2_refidx1_active G2_DEC_REG(9, 19, 0x1f)
#define g2_refidx0_active G2_DEC_REG(9, 14, 0x1f)
diff --git a/drivers/staging/media/hantro/hantro_hevc.c b/drivers/staging/media/hantro/hantro_hevc.c
index 1b2da990fbf0..1d44ea69c930 100644
--- a/drivers/staging/media/hantro/hantro_hevc.c
+++ b/drivers/staging/media/hantro/hantro_hevc.c
@@ -195,6 +195,7 @@ static int tile_buffer_reallocate(struct hantro_ctx *ctx)
const struct v4l2_ctrl_hevc_sps *sps = ctrls->sps;
unsigned int num_tile_cols = pps->num_tile_columns_minus1 + 1;
unsigned int height64 = (sps->pic_height_in_luma_samples + 63) & ~63;
+ unsigned int pixel_depth = sps->bit_depth_luma_minus8 == 0 ? 8 : 10;
unsigned int size;
if (num_tile_cols <= 1 ||
@@ -223,7 +224,7 @@ static int tile_buffer_reallocate(struct hantro_ctx *ctx)
hevc_dec->tile_bsd.cpu = NULL;
}
- size = VERT_FILTER_RAM_SIZE * height64 * (num_tile_cols - 1);
+ size = (VERT_FILTER_RAM_SIZE * height64 * (num_tile_cols - 1) * pixel_depth) / 8;
hevc_dec->tile_filter.cpu = dma_alloc_coherent(vpu->dev, size,
&hevc_dec->tile_filter.dma,
GFP_KERNEL);
@@ -231,7 +232,7 @@ static int tile_buffer_reallocate(struct hantro_ctx *ctx)
goto err_free_tile_buffers;
hevc_dec->tile_filter.size = size;
- size = VERT_SAO_RAM_SIZE * height64 * (num_tile_cols - 1);
+ size = (VERT_SAO_RAM_SIZE * height64 * (num_tile_cols - 1) * pixel_depth) / 8;
hevc_dec->tile_sao.cpu = dma_alloc_coherent(vpu->dev, size,
&hevc_dec->tile_sao.dma,
GFP_KERNEL);
--
2.25.1
